Minister of Justice, Radu Marinescu: "I do not think that the Prime Minister is not considering the phasing-in formula because it has been outlined as a certainty of the transfer to the age of 65"

Radu Marinescu, Minister of Justice, discussed the increase of the retirement age for magistrates to 65, emphasizing that this should be phased in, according to the law of 2023. Currently, the average retirement age for magistrates is 52-54, and the law provides for a gradual increase to 60. Marinescu noted that an increase to 65 cannot be decided immediately, respecting the mechanisms established by the Constitutional Court.
